This cool NoDa townhouse is walking distance from the best spots in the neighborhood. It’s listed at $315K.
Situational awareness: In the 28205 zip code, single-family homes from 900- to 1,350 square feet sold for $328,395 on average over the last six months. Condos and townhouses of similar square footage in that zip code sold for $246,103, on average.
- Given its walkable location, size and unique style, this condo is one of the best deals in the neighborhood.
The exact address is 3560 Artists Way Unit 1. At 1,127 square feet, it has 2 beds and 2 baths.
About: The former manufacturing building was converted to condos in 2007 and 2008, listing agent DJ Pomposini tells me.
- The industrial-style condo features 20-foot ceilings, concrete floors and a retractable glass wall that opens to the front patio.
- There are two bedrooms (one upstairs and one down) and a spacious loft that could be a home office, guest space, etc.
Some highlights of this end unit include the walkable location, light-filled interior, community fire pit and grill and its charming patio. Plus, the $260 HOA dues cover internet, cable, water, trash and HVAC quarterly maintenance.

Each unit presents almost like a storefront with an industrial-style roll-up garage door. It creates an indoor-outdoor space between the patio and living area.

This unit has 20-foot ceilings, exposed beams and wood ceilings (called bow truss), and concrete floors.

You can roll up the garage door to let light and fresh air in!

The primary bedroom is one the first floor and has an attached bath.

Upstairs is another bedroom and a loft, which can function as a guest room, home office, etc.

This sliding barn door allows for more privacy between the loft and bedroom.

The community has a fire pit and grill area, plus its walkable to parks and some of the best spots in NoDa.
